Overview Robero L 75mg/20mg Capsule SR

G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D), peptic ulcers, and irritable bowel syndrome may be treated with the prescription medication, Robero L 75mg/20mg sustained-release capsules. This medication lessens excessive stomach acid production and prevents its backflow into the esophagus. Dosage and duration for Robero L 75mg/20mg SR capsules are determined by your physician and should be taken with or without food. Treatment length depends on your response and condition. Prem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and worsening condition. Inform your healthcare provider of all other medications you're using, as interactions are possible. Common side effects, often transient, include nausea, abdominal discomfort, diarrhea, gas, constipation, headache, fatigue, and flu-like symptoms. Report any concerning side effects immediately to your doctor. Dizziness and drowsiness are potential side effects; avoid driving or activities requiring alertness until their impact is known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. A fiber-rich diet, avoidance of trigger foods, increased hydration, and regular physical activity can enhance treatment outcomes. Prior to starting Robero L, disclose any liver or kidney conditions, pregnancy, pregnancy plans, or breastfeeding to your doctor.

How Robero L 75mg/20mg Capsule SR works:

Levosulpiride, a prokinetic agent, enhances gastrointestinal motility by stimulating acetylcholine release. This heightened activity accelerates stomach and intestinal transit, thereby mitigating reflux. In contrast, rabeprazole, a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), diminishes gastric acid production, providing relief from acid indigestion and peptic ulcers.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Combining Robero L 75mg/20mg SR capsules with alcohol is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Robero L 75mg/20mg sustained-release cap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against any possible risks prior to prescribing this medication.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on the use of Robero L 75mg/20mg sustained-release capsules while breastfeeding is absent.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ving ability may be impaired by the side effects of Robero L 75mg/20mg sustained-release capsules.

KidneyKidney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Insufficient data exists regarding the use of Robero L 75mg/20mg sustained-release capsules in individuals with renal impairment. Physician consultation is recommended. Nevertheless, preliminary findings indicate potential for cautious administration in such cases.

LiverLiverCAUTION

The extended-release Robero L 75mg/20mg capsules require careful administration for individuals experiencing severe hepatic impairment. Dosage modification of Robero L 75mg/20mg capsules may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

FAQs on Robero L 75mg/20mg Capsule SR

Always follow your doctor's instructions when taking Robero L 75mg/20mg SR Capsules. A single capsule daily, taken on an empty stomach, is recommended.
Patients allergic to any component or excipient of Robero L 75mg/20mg SR Capsules should not use this medication.
Robero L 75mg/20mg SR Capsules may cause dizziness, lightheadedness, weakness, or faintness in some individuals. If this occurs, rest until symptoms subside before resuming activities.
Studies in adults indicate a potential link between Robero L 75mg/20mg Capsule SR treatment and an elevated risk of hip, wrist, or spine fractures related to osteoporosis. This fracture risk is heightened with high doses, defined as multiple daily doses or prolonged use (one year or more).
Driving or operating machinery is not advised while taking Robero L 75mg/20mg Capsule SR, as it may cause drowsiness, dizziness, or visual disturbances.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ions on the packaging. Discard any unused medication and ensure it's in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
